diff --git a/lib/sf/session.rb b/lib/sf/session.rb index b02be9c..a4a8557 100644 --- a/lib/sf/session.rb +++ b/lib/sf/session.rb @@ -32,7 +32,6 @@ def proposal_attrs attrs['event__c'] = sf_event.Id attrs['title__c'] = proposal.session_title attrs['abstract__c'] = proposal.abstract - attrs['cms_proposal_id__c'] = proposal.id attrs['submitter_email__c'] = proposal.submitter_email attrs['submitter_phone__c'] = proposal.submitter_phone attrs['cms_proposal_id__c'] = proposal.id @@ -40,14 +39,8 @@ def proposal_attrs sf_session_type = Sf::SessionType.find_by(reg_event__c: sf_event.Id, cms_session_type_id__c: session_type_id) attrs['session_type__c'] = sf_session_type.Id unless sf_session_type.blank? end - if (primary_track_id = proposal.primary_track_id) - sf_primary_track = Sf::Track.find_by(reg_event_id__c: sf_event.Id, cms_track_id__c: primary_track_id) - attrs['primary_track_id__c'] = sf_primary_track.Id unless sf_primary_track.blank? - end - if (secondary_track_id = proposal.secondary_track_id) - sf_secondary_track = Sf::Track.find_by(reg_event_id__c: sf_event.Id, cms_track_id__c: secondary_track_id) - attrs['secondary_track_id__c'] = sf_secondary_track.Id unless sf_secondary_track.blank? - end + attrs['primary_track_id__c'] = proposal.primary_track_id + attrs['secondary_track_id__c'] = proposal.secondary_track_id attrs['timestamp__c'] = Time.now.iso8601 attrs['cms_meeting_id__c'] = meeting_id attrs diff --git a/lib/sf/version.rb b/lib/sf/version.rb index 3e2bf63..bd8168f 100644 --- a/lib/sf/version.rb +++ b/lib/sf/version.rb @@ -1,5 +1,5 @@ # frozen_string_literal: true module Sf - VERSION = '0.1.75' + VERSION = '0.1.76' end